The increase in the prevalence of periodontitis is expected to drive the growth of the dental flap surgery market. Periodontitis is a condition characterized by infection and inflammation of the gum tissue and the bone that support the teeth. Dental flap surgery is commonly performed on patients with mild to severe gum disease who do not respond adequately to non-surgical treatments such as scaling and root planing. For instance, in March 2025, according to the World Health Organization, a UN agency responsible for international public health, severe periodontal disease was estimated to affect around 1 billion people worldwide. As a result, the rising prevalence of periodontitis is contributing to the growth of the dental flap surgery market.
The growing aging population is also playing a significant role in supporting the expansion of the dental flap surgery market going forward. Older individuals are more prone to periodontal diseases, and as the global population continues to age, the demand for dental flap surgery to manage age-related oral health conditions is increasing. For example, in February 2025, based on reports published by the World Health Organization, a US-based specialized health agency, global life expectancy at birth reached 73.3 years in 2024, and the population aged 60 years and above is projected to rise from 1.1 billion in 2023 to 1.4 billion by 2030. Therefore, the expanding aging population is expected to drive demand for dental flap surgery.

Dental flap surgery is a surgical procedure that involves creating small incisions to separate the gum tissue from the underlying bone, allowing the exposed tooth and root surfaces to be accessed and cleaned. This procedure is commonly used to treat gum diseases in which the bone supporting the teeth has been damaged.
The primary flap types used in dental flap surgery include trapezoidal flap, triangular flap, envelope flap, semilunar flap, and pedicle flap, with incision types categorized as horizontal and vertical. The trapezoidal flap is commonly employed for third molar extractions. A trapezoidal or three-sided flap consists of a horizontal incision along the gingival crevice, followed by two vertical releasing incisions on the medial and distal sides. Techniques used in dental flap surgery include the modified Widman flap, undisplaced flap, and apically displaced flap. These procedures are typically performed in hospitals and dental clinics.
